ELISA kits are commonly used to measure soluble biomarkers across a variety of research areas. ELISA kits for Rat IgE can be quantified in various samples, including plasma, serum.
Invitrogen ELISA kits exist in two formats: Uncoated and Coated. Uncoated ELISA kits include all the necessary reagents to coat your own plates and run your assay with maximum flexibility. Coated ELISA kits are ready-to-use and quality tested for sensitivity, specificity, precision and lot-to-lot consistency.

Rat IgE, also referred to as rat immunoglobulin E, is an antibody isotype synthesized by rats in response to allergens or parasites. It plays a pivotal role in mediating allergic reactions and immune responses against specific pathogens. IgE antibodies are primarily responsible for eliciting the release of inflammatory mediators, such as histamine, from mast cells and basophils. This immune response can give rise to symptoms like pruritus, edema, and bronchoconstriction. Investigating the genetic target Rat IgE can provide valuable insights into the underlying mechanisms of allergic diseases and contribute to the development of innovative therapeutic strategies for allergies and immunological disorders in both rats and humans.
